#b8059c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b8059c is composed of 72.2% red, 2% green and 61.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 97.3% magenta, 15.2% yellow and 27.8% black. It has a hue angle of 309.4 degrees, a saturation of 94.7% and a lightness of 37.1%. #b8059c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0aff with #710039. Closest websafe color is: #cc0099.

#b8059c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#b8059c has RGB values of R:184, G:5, B:156 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.97, Y:0.15, K:0.28. Its decimal value is 12060060.

Hex triplet b8059c #b8059c
RGB Decimal 184, 5, 156 rgb(184,5,156)
RGB Percent 72.2, 2, 61.2 rgb(72.2%,2%,61.2%)
CMYK 0, 97, 15, 28
HSL 309.4°, 94.7, 37.1 hsl(309.4,94.7%,37.1%)
HSV (or HSB) 309.4°, 97.3, 72.2
Web Safe cc0099 #cc0099
CIE-LAB 42.31, 72.498, -33.185
XYZ 25.822, 12.701, 32.542
xyY 0.363, 0.179, 12.701
CIE-LCH 42.31, 79.732, 335.405
CIE-LUV 42.31, 72.128, -57.34
Hunter-Lab 35.639, 66.963, -29.191
Binary 10111000, 00000101, 10011100

Shades and Tints of #b8059c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c000a is the darkest color, while #fff8fe is the lightest one.
